Forum Linux.général Droits d’exécution des applis différents pour chaque user

Posté par  .
Étiquettes : aucune
0
8
août
2012

Bonjour,

Mes petits bambins grandissant, j'aimerais les initier au monde de l'informatique et leurs configurant un (vieux) PC sous linux. J'ai eu une idée géniale, mais je ne sais pas comment la mettre en œuvre.
J'aimerais que chacun ai un compte avec accès aux applications suivant leur âge :

  • le plus jeune 4 ans pourrais avoir accès aux jeux éducatifs et non violent.
  • le précédent, 6 ans pourrais avoir accès à icedove pour écrire des mail, plus des jeux un peu mieux
  • la précédente, 8 ans pourrais avoir accès à d'autres applications…
  • l'ainé 10 ans, pourrais avoir accès aux jeux qui tuent, et éventuellement à iceweasel avec un mot de passe…

Savez-vous si il existe un moyen de faire cela ?

Pour l'instant, mon idée est de faire une installation minimale, et installer les applications nécessaire au fur et à mesure. Pour chaque applications configurer les droits d’exécution et les groupes POSIX. Je trouve ça un peu compliqué. Si vous savez comment faire plus simple, je suis preneur.

Bonnes vacances…

  • # asri

    Posté par  . Évalué à 1.

    • [^] # Re: asri

      Posté par  . Évalué à 1.

      Merci, mais les distro orientées éducations ne me plaisent guère, il y a trop d'applications inutiles. Je préfère leur mettre moi même ce dont ils ont besoin!

  • # Encore du temps

    Posté par  . Évalué à 2. Dernière modification le 08 août 2012 à 21:25.

    Mes petits ont chacun une session avec un GNOME3 avec chacun leurs jeux en accès direct dans le dock. Pour l'instant (le grand a 6 ans) ils n'en sont pas encore à chercher à personnaliser leur interface pour avoir accès à autre chose. Après je pense que c'est une question d'éducation.

    Au pire tu configure un WM mnimal de sorte qu'il ne puisse pas lancer facilement autre chose. Je pense par exemple avec juste une poignée d'icônes sur le bureau, pas de dock, pas de menu, pas de barre de lancement, pas de raccourcis clavier… le temps qu'ils apprennent tout seul à contourner ça, c'est que tu les auras bien éduqué!

    • [^] # Re: Encore du temps

      Posté par  . Évalué à 1.

      J'avais pensé à cette option, mais je trouve ça trop simple. Ils trouveront vite comment contourner le problème ! Je vais tout de même essayer ça si je ne trouve pas d'autre solutions.

      • [^] # Re: Encore du temps

        Posté par  . Évalué à 2.

        mais je trouve ça trop simple. Ils trouveront vite comment contourner le problème !

        Euh, pour cotoyer pas mal "d'enfant" un peu plus vieux (je suis prof en collège), je peux te dire qu'il sont très loin de savoir contourner ce genre de problème. Certes ils sont balèze en FB (et encore c'est pas la majorité).

        Si ils sont capable de trouver tout seul (si tu leur montre, forcément!) comment lancer une appli depuis un WM que tu aurais bien vérouiller (un FVWM ferait une bonne base), je pense qu'il ne mettront pas longtemps à apprendre comment prendre le contrôle de l'ordi au boot ou à se servir d'un liveCD.

        Mais je pense que la principale solution est simplement de ne pas laisser les enfants seuls devant un ordi!

        • [^] # Re: Encore du temps

          Posté par  . Évalué à 0.

          Je suis d'accord qu'il ne faut pas les laisser tout seul, c'est pour cela que je veux sélectionner drastiquement les applications. Le navigateur web ne sera pas installé.
          La principale application que je veux qu'ils puissent faire librement, c'est les mail et de l'office. Les jeux viendraient en prime.

  • # abuledu/skolinux

    Posté par  . Évalué à 2.

    abduledu/skolinux, etc sont des distribs orientés educations, et y a surement des profils d'utilisateurs

  • # poussons le concept jusqu'au bout

    Posté par  . Évalué à 2.

    transforme le vieux PC en terminal graphique
    au boot, ca part sur le reseau, tu as un OS par enfant, verrouiller par mot de passe, que seul le gamin connait (t'inquietes, ills vont se l'echanger)
    mais comme c'est une machine en remote desktop, tu leurs donne pas la main, et meme s'ils passent root de la machine locale, y a rien dessus, donc zero risques

    maintenant comme dit certain plus haut, les enfants jusqu'a un certain age, çà ne devrait pas etre tout seul devant le PC.

  • # Changement des groups

    Posté par  . Évalué à 0.

    J'ai fait un test.
    Pour les appli que je veux restreindre :
    - je créé un nouveau group : N1 (niveau 1 de restriction)
    - j'enlève la possibilité de lancer les binaire à filtrer à other : chmod o-x monjeu
    - je change le groupe de ce prog : chgrp N1 monjeu
    - je mets le utilisateurs qui peuvent accéder à ce prog dans le group N1. Sinon, personne n'y a accès

    Je crois que je vais adopter cette stratégie.
    Merci à tous de m'avoir fait avancé dans ma propre réflexion.

    • [^] # Re: Changement des groups

      Posté par  . Évalué à 0.

      Je viens d'installer une debian minimale avec :
      Icedove pour qu'il puissent envoyer des messages.
      Libreoffice pour de la bureautique.

      Le reste se fera sur le PC familiale.

      Tout simplement. Merci nunux pour cette possibilité extraordinaire..

  • # Mouais

    Posté par  (site web personnel) . Évalué à 1.

    Ca va mettre combien de temps avant qu'ils demandent tous à l'ainé d'utiliser son compte ?

    • [^] # Re: Mouais

      Posté par  . Évalué à 0.

      Là tu as raison, c'est là que réside le danger. Mais la différence entre les comptes ne sera pas très grosse suivant mes plans… Et c'est là qu'intervient le problème d'éducation cité plus haut.
      Je ne suis d'ailleurs pas obliger de leur donner le mot de passe !

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.